The research project titled "Investigating the impact of climate change on coastal communities: a case study of a vulnerable region" focuses on examining the effects of climate change on coastal communities within a specific vulnerable region. Climate change is a pressing global issue with far-reaching consequences, particularly for coastal areas that are highly susceptible to its impacts. The vulnerability of coastal communities is exacerbated by factors such as rising sea levels, increased storm frequency and intensity, and coastal erosion. The study aims to provide a comprehensive analysis of how climate change is affecting these coastal communities, with a particular emphasis on a specific region that is deemed vulnerable to these changes. By conducting a case study, the project seeks to delve deep into the specific challenges and impacts faced by communities in this region, providing valuable insights that can inform future adaptation and mitigation strategies. Through a combination of qualitative and quantitative research methods, the project will gather data on the current state of the coastal communities in the vulnerable region, including socio-economic conditions, infrastructure, environmental conditions, and community resilience. This data will be analyzed to identify the specific impacts of climate change on these communities, such as increased flooding, loss of habitat, economic disruptions, and social displacement. Furthermore, the research will explore the existing adaptation and mitigation measures implemented in the region to address the impacts of climate change. By examining the effectiveness of these strategies and their relevance to the local context, the project aims to provide recommendations for enhancing resilience and sustainability in the face of climate change.
